Transaction 881ce80531d516f941e18d60332184a251ae298181ffbcd4df3ea527077a2550

1 Input
2 Outputs
  • 881ce80531d516f941e18d60332184a251ae298181ffbcd4df3ea527077a2550:0
  • value  1199498
    address  2MwuaSHyVcKDTiLdp6SghaBFPUxGELNFxav
  • 881ce80531d516f941e18d60332184a251ae298181ffbcd4df3ea527077a2550:1
  • value  1000000
    address  2N3WHv2xnP6QLayeN1zNM2ViymRbwrQZHtM